| Subject: Fallout New Vegas Lag Tue Feb 07, 2017 3:55 pm | |
| So I fixed all my stutter issues but now it seems to just be lag spikes. I get the lag spikes when there are large amounts of NPCs in the area or if it is loading new objects. I am also using TTW and when I am in the CW the lag is worse then it is in the Mojave. |

| Subject: Re: Fallout New Vegas Lag Mon Feb 13, 2017 1:32 pm | |
| If you have NVSR installed go into the ini and change bHookLightCriticalSections to =0 if it's not already. I had bad stuttering problems but I disabled that setting in the ini and my game has been running smoothly ever since. But I may have had a different problem than what you're having so I apologize if that's the case. |

| Subject: Re: Fallout New Vegas Lag Mon Feb 13, 2017 1:41 pm | |
| TTW has been known to have bad fps in the Capital Wasteland. It's because the world spaces in FO3 are much more complicated than in NV.
There's not much really you can do apart from NVSR, downgrading settings and so on. Be glad that you can even run anything on the terrible gamebryo engine at all. |
